I need a little assistance on a filter. %BOS %Manually Created Score [*.*] Score: =-9999 %Google Groups Message-ID: googlegroups\.com ~From: <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> %EOS
According to the slrn score.txt at http://www.slrn.org/docs/score.txt, The `Score' keyword is used to assign a score to the header. If it is followed by a single colon, the score is only given if all tests are passed (logical AND); two colons indicate that the score should be awarded if any of the tests are passed (logical OR). However, no matter whether I use one or two colons, the above filter kills all posts. Looking at the posts' score, it reads "Any of these tests pass." That isn't the way it's supposed to work. Is it?
